Public bug reported: Unable to upgrade from Ubuntu 22.04.5 to 24.04.2 using do-release- upgrade command.
Yes, I've tried researching on Google and some say reinstall snapd and some say like remove pipewire ppa or something like that. I've tried everything that I found online still no luck.
